Three beautifully illustrated books help beginning readers understand fundamental ideas about the Sun, the Moon, the planets and the stars. The text is easy to read, and full-color illustrations fill every page. A two-page section at the back of each book is written for parents and teachers, and suggests ways in which they can further explain the universe and its objects to very young children. Books may be purchased individually or as a three-volume set in an attractive slipcase.This book will familiarize children with Earth's nearest neighbors: the Sun, the Moon, and the planets.… (more)
